Quality Testing
The cornerstone of success is stringent quality control. Can you be sure the product you are wearing conforms to EN ISO 20471? A certificate from a test house guarantees that the garment or fabric sent to the test house has attained the EN ISO 20471 standard. It is not a guarantee that the bulk production meets the standard. Therefore, it is necessary that every roll of fabric and retro reflective tape is tested with highly specialised equipment which guarantees that all production meets the EN ISO 20471 standard.

HIVISTEX REFLECTIVE TAPE
HiVisTex is the latest innovation in reflective tape material. HiVisTex tape is constructed from thousands of premium, wide angle, glass beads, placed per centimetre squared. These beads work like thousands of tiny mirrors, reflecting light back towards its source as a brilliant white glow. Perfect for use in the protective clothing industries HiVisTex tape ensures the wearer ultimate visibility in low light conditions.

RETROREFLECTOMETER
This is for checking the performance of retroreflective tape. Every roll of tape is tested to ensure it meets and exceeds the standard requirements. The retroflectometer measures the coefficient of two rotating angles. EN ISO 20471 states the reading should not be below 330 (cd/lx.m2) however at Portwest we insist on a reading of 400 (cd/lx.m2) plus.

Fabric Testing
In the quality control laboratory the Minolta Spectrophotometer is used to check every roll of fabric. This guarantees that the fabric used is fully compliant to the EN ISO 20471 standard.
